SB out of town on Rue Témiscouata, approaching QC 191 after this bridge. The QC 185 shield and similarly old parking sign probably both predate A-85, when this was still part of QC 185.


Looking south and north along Wolf River (that's English for Rivière-du-Loup) at the old QC 185 bridge south of downtown.


There's an old railroad bridge just north of there, too.


SB from the former beginning of QC 185 under the railroad that's coming off of the bridge you just saw. The distance signs are obviously also as old as the first signs on this page. The graffiti is odd, as the town is named Dégelis, not Dégelés - the latter is the plural masculine form of "deiced," which does not pair well with the singular feminine "ville."
